What is Jennifer Doudna’s Main Contribution to Science?

Jennifer Doudna’s main contribution to science lies in her co-development of CRISPR-Cas9, a groundbreaking gene-editing tool that allows for precise, targeted modifications to the DNA of living organisms. This innovation has revolutionized genetics, molecular biology, and medicine, offering new possibilities for treating genetic disorders and advancing our understanding of fundamental biological processes.

Who Received the 3 Million Dollar Breakthrough Prize for Inventing CRISPR-Cas9 as well as the Nobel Prize?

Jennifer Doudna and Emmanuelle Charpentier were jointly awarded the $3 million Breakthrough Prize and the Nobel Prize in Chemistry for their invention of CRISPR-Cas9. This historic recognition not only highlights their significant contribution to science but also marks a milestone in acknowledging the achievements of women in the field of biochemistry.

What Companies Does Jennifer Doudna Own?

Jennifer Doudna’s entrepreneurial ventures extend her influence beyond the laboratory. She has co-founded several biotech companies leveraging CRISPR technology, including Caribou Biosciences, Editas Medicine, and CRISPR Therapeutics. These enterprises exemplify her commitment to translating scientific discoveries into practical applications, impacting various industries, and advancing human health.

  3. How does CRISPR-Cas9 work? CRISPR-Cas9 works by utilizing a guide RNA to target specific DNA sequences within an organism’s genome, allowing for precise editing of genetic material.
  4. What potential applications does CRISPR technology have? CRISPR technology has wide-ranging applications, including treating genetic disorders, improving crop resilience, and researching diseases.
